Qualcomm confirms its processors are getting more expensive
During Qualcomm’s third-quarter fiscal earnings call on Wednesday, CEO Cristiano Amon confirmed what many of us were already worried about – Snapdragon chipsets are about to get more expensive, starting on 1 September.
In an interview with CNBC following the call, Amon put it very simply; “costs went up, prices are going to go up,”.

Apparently, overall profits in Qualcomm’s smartphone chip business are down 20% over the past 12 months, though I should say it still made a whopping $1.5 billion on chips in that period, so it’s not exactly a loss leader. Capitalism, guys…
Anyway, that drop is likely the main driver behind the increases in prices of the chipsets for manufacturers like Xiaomi, Samsung, Honor and Oppo that tend to use Snapdragon chipsets, especially in their top-end market.
The price increases aren’t just for upcoming chipsets; they also apply to existing chipsets, including the popular Snapdragon 8 Elite Gen 5, from early September.
That’ll make already-expensive phones even pricier in 2027
It’d be nice to think that smartphone manufacturers would take one for the team, as it were, and absorb these ‘temporary’ component price hikes. After all, these manufacturers are reporting millions, if not billions, in revenue each year. But, of course, that’s not going to happen.
We’ve already seen price hikes across smartphones across the wider market due to AI data centre-driven RAM and storage shortages, and while that at first affected mainly cheap and mid-range phones, even top-end premium phones – which already cost in excess of £1000/$1000 depending on what you go for – are getting more expensive.

Just yesterday, a report came out suggesting that the iPhone 18 Pro could be $300 more expensive this year, and Apple, quite famously, doesn’t use Qualcomm’s smartphone chips.
Other manufacturers, however, will have to juggle not only RAM and storage increases but also increases in Snapdragon chipsets. Samsung and its in-house-developed Exynos chipsets could avoid the worst of the hikes by forgoing the custom Snapdragon chipsets it tends to use in top-end phones, but manufacturers like Oppo, Honor, Nothing, Motorola, and the like don’t have much choice.
And what does that mean? Paying more, sometimes for less, than what you would’ve a year ago.
We don’t need the power of most top-end chipsets
The worst part about this is that, really and truly, we don’t need the latest and greatest chipsets, even in most top-end phones.
Looking at benchmark performance for flagships like the Samsung Galaxy S26 Ultra, Oppo Find X9 Ultra and Honor Magic 8 Pro, there’s way more power under the hood than the Android operating system and the vast majority of apps can take advantage of right now.

That’s great for futureproofing, of course, meaning the chipset can continue to perform as app and OS demands grow naturally over time – but it could also be our saving grace during this component crisis.
What if, instead of going all-in on whatever the next flagship Snapdragon processor will be – likely the 8 Elite Gen 6, due for announcement sometime in the next few months – manufacturers just decided to stick with the (assumingly) cheaper 8 Elite Gen 5 for another year?

Would we even really notice day-to-day? For 99% of users, I very much doubt it. I recently used the Samsung Galaxy S25 Plus for a week for a piece I was working on, a phone with the Snapdragon 8 Elite chipset that came out close to two years ago now, and it felt every bit as fast and responsive as the Galaxy S26 Ultra does in everyday use.
